Output 56675e03a27eabb53c676d33744c833539029e8b31ba9ce7ed1d0e7e1b276636:5

value
32266523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e535a0563ec2378ef0f5943cbaa69865d2c15bfd OP_EQUAL
address
MUo7DP4K1LQNycGY8976CKDYrazP84RLz5
transaction
56675e03a27eabb53c676d33744c833539029e8b31ba9ce7ed1d0e7e1b276636
spent
true